Gay refers to the attraction towards or desire for the same gender (or similar genders to one's own). Terms such as homosexual and homoromantic can be considered synonyms or subcategories of gay. While the term gay can apply to men, women, and non-binary individuals, it is sometimes used to only refer to gay men. The term lesbian tends to be used specifically for gay women.

Homosexuality is romantic attraction, sexual attraction, or sexual behavior between people of the same sex or gender. [1][2][3] It also denotes identity based on attraction, related behavior, and community affiliation. [4][5] Along with bisexuality and heterosexuality, homosexuality is one of the three main categories of sexual orientation within the heterosexual–homosexual continuum. [4 ...
